Home Restoration in Conroe, TX
Home restoration services encompass a range of projects aimed at repairing, improving, and revitalizing residential properties. These services often include addressing structural damages, repairing or replacing damaged surfaces, restoring interiors after water or fire damage, and updating features to enhance the home's appearance and functionality. Property owners typically seek restoration after events like storms, leaks, or accidents, or when preparing a home for sale or occupancy. Understanding the scope of work, the materials involved, and the process involved in restoring a property can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ting services.
Before requesting home restoration, property owners should consider the extent of damage or renovation needed, the desired outcome, and any specific concerns about materials or finishes. Clarifying the project's scope helps ensure that the restoration aligns with expectations and requirements. It is also useful to inquire about the timeline, potential disruptions, and any necessary preparations to facilitate a smooth process. Being informed about these aspects can lead to a more efficient restoration experience and a result that meets the homeowner’s needs.

Common Home Restoration Jobs
Kitchen Renovations - upgrades include cabinet replacement, countertop installation, and layout improvements.
Bathroom Remodels - updates feature new fixtures, tile work, and accessibility enhancements.
Flooring Replacement - installs new hardwood, tile, or carpet to refresh interior spaces.
Roof Repairs and Replacement - addresses leaks, damage, and overall roof system upgrades.
Interior Painting - enhances home aesthetics with color updates and surface preparation.
Basement Finishing - transforms unfinished spaces into functional living or recreational areas.
Home Restoration Questions
What types of home restoration services are available? Services include repairs for water damage, fire damage restoration, mold removal, and general renovation to restore property condition.
How can home restoration improve property value? Restoring damaged or outdated areas enhances the appearance and functionality of a home, potentially increasing its market value.
What should homeowners consider before starting restoration work? It's important to assess the extent of damage, choose appropriate materials, and ensure proper planning for a smooth process.
Are there specific projects commonly requested for home restoration? Common projects include basement waterproofing, roof repairs, siding replacement, and interior remodeling after damage or wear.
